Intouch Solutions proudly announces the promotion of five employees in its Chicago office. A leading marketing agency serving the pharmaceutical industry,
Intouch Solutions has seen rapid expansion over the past five years and actively promotes within
the 650-person firm.

Grace Pollert, office manager, joined Intouch in July 2013 as an office coordinator and has since
become an invaluable member of the Chicago team. In fact, Pollert’s new office manager position
did not even exist prior to her promotion. Dedicated and hardworking, Pollert’s responsibilities
include managing administrative and office budgets, facilitating office expansions, and planning
events that take place both on and off site. Pollert is also tasked with preparing for client meetings
and contributing to social media, working closely with Intouch’s IT, HR and finance departments.
Pollert continuously encourages other Intouchers to look to her as a resource and enables the
everyday operations of the Chicago office.

Joe Abella, VP of planning, is a key member of the planning team at Intouch’s Chicago office.
Since joining Intouch in August 2012 as a planning director, Abella has proved his dedication and
strategic thinking and risen through the ranks to be named vice president of planning. In this new
position, Abella will oversee the Chicago planning team, consisting of eight planners who work on
key accounts for the agency. Abella’s role will also include enterprise planning for these accounts
and ensuring the planning team has the resources and skills to deliver key insights and elevate the
quality of work Intouch produces.
